Scales numerical

Aon’s standard numerical reasoning format has 37 statements and a 12-minute clock. You evaluate statements using tables and charts. This is the format covered by our full practice.

Aon also supplies arithmetic, memory and logic tasks. A digitChallenge or gapChallenge invitation calls for different practice. Aon is the provider, not the name of one universal exam.

1. Read the unit before comparing values

Marlow Displays: annual revenue

Figures are in thousands of pounds (£000). The years are calendar years; forecast figures are estimates.

Revenue by year

Revenue by year
YearStatusRevenue (£000)
2024Actual2,480
2025Actual2,735
2026Forecast2,910

Marlow Displays’ actual revenue in 2025 exceeded £2.7 million.

Show answer and explanation

Correct answer: True

  1. Use the 2025 actual row, not the forecast for 2026.
  2. The value 2,735 is in thousands: 2,735 × £1,000 = £2,735,000.
  3. £2,735,000 is £35,000 above £2,700,000, so the statement is true.

Read the period, status and scale together. The same number means something different in pounds, thousands of pounds or millions of pounds.

2. Separate percentages from percentage points

Marlow Displays: defective-item rate

The rate is the number of defective items divided by all items inspected in that year. Rates below are exact.

Annual inspection results

Annual inspection results
YearDefective-item rate
20242.4%
20253.0%

The defective-item rate increased by 0.6% relative to its 2024 level.

Show answer and explanation

Correct answer: False

  1. The subtraction 3.0% − 2.4% gives 0.6 percentage points.
  2. A relative increase uses the original rate as its base: (3.0 − 2.4) ÷ 2.4 × 100 = 25%.
  3. The relative increase is 25%, not 0.6%. The figures contradict the statement.

“Percentage points” means subtract the two percentages. “Relative increase” means divide the difference by the original value.

3. Compare output per hour

Kestrel Dispatch: one week’s completed parcels

Dock A used 24 staff-hours. Dock B used 30 staff-hours. Staff-hours combine the hours worked by everyone at that dock. The chart gives exact parcel counts.

Completed parcels

Scroll horizontally or expand to read the full graphic.

Text description

Horizontal bar chart. Dock A completed 960 parcels. Dock B completed 1,080 parcels.

Dock A completed at least 10% more parcels per staff-hour than Dock B.

Show answer and explanation

Correct answer: True

  1. Dock A’s rate was 960 ÷ 24 = 40 parcels per staff-hour.
  2. Dock B’s rate was 1,080 ÷ 30 = 36 parcels per staff-hour.
  3. Relative to Dock B, the difference was (40 − 36) ÷ 36 × 100 = 11.11…%. This is above 10%.

Dock B completed more parcels in total, but Dock A had the higher rate. Compare the quantity named in the statement.

4. Weight an average by the number of cases

Kestrel Dispatch: handling times

These are all 100 orders handled on Monday. Each order belongs to exactly one group. The group means are exact.

Orders and mean handling time

Orders and mean handling time
Order groupOrdersMean minutes per order
Large2012
Small807

The mean handling time across all 100 orders was 9.5 minutes per order.

Show answer and explanation

Correct answer: False

  1. Large orders account for 20 × 12 = 240 minutes. Small orders account for 80 × 7 = 560 minutes.
  2. Total handling time is 240 + 560 = 800 minutes across 100 orders.
  3. The overall mean is 800 ÷ 100 = 8 minutes. Averaging the two group means gives 9.5, but incorrectly gives the unequal groups equal weight.

Combine total quantities first, then divide by the total count. Simply averaging the group means can give the wrong result when the group sizes differ.

5. Apply each forecast change to the updated total

Marlow Displays: quarterly order forecast

The company forecasts 8% growth in order volume from Q4 2025 to Q1 2026, then another 8% from Q1 to Q2 2026. Each change is applied to the preceding quarter. No other adjustments are included.

Starting order volume

Starting order volume
QuarterStatusOrders
Q4 2025Actual1,250

Under this forecast, order volume in Q2 2026 will be 1,458.

Show answer and explanation

Correct answer: True

  1. Forecast Q1 volume: 1,250 × 1.08 = 1,350 orders.
  2. Forecast Q2 volume: 1,350 × 1.08 = 1,458 orders.
  3. The statement is about the specified forecast, so it is supported. It does not claim that the actual future result is guaranteed.

Two successive 8% increases compound to 16.64%, not 16%. Keep forecasts separate from actual outcomes, and do not extend a growth rule beyond the periods stated.

6. Recognize when the data measure something else

Kestrel Dispatch: annual transport expense

Total transport expense was £50,000. The chart splits that expense by transport method. Delivery counts and cost per delivery are not supplied.

Share of transport expense

Scroll horizontally or expand to read the full graphic.

Text description

Stacked bar of transport expense shares: Road 45%, Rail 35%, Air 20%. These are cost shares, not delivery shares.

More deliveries traveled by road than by rail.

Show answer and explanation

Correct answer: Cannot Say

  1. Road accounted for 45% of £50,000 = £22,500. Rail accounted for 35% = £17,500.
  2. These are expenses. The number of deliveries also depends on cost per delivery, which is missing.
  3. A higher total expense could arise from more deliveries, more expensive deliveries, or both. The statement is neither established nor contradicted.

Cannot Say is a definite answer about insufficient evidence. It does not mean that a calculation feels difficult, and it is different from leaving a statement unanswered.

Use three different evidence judgments

True

The supplied figures support the statement. Check the exact period, measure and comparison before choosing it.

False

The supplied figures contradict the statement. You can establish that its claim is wrong.

Cannot Say

The supplied information leaves the statement unresolved. You would need another figure, period or definition to decide.

An unanswered statement is different: you have not submitted a judgment. Do not choose Cannot Say merely because the arithmetic is difficult. You should be able to name the missing evidence.

Find the right sheet before calculating

Aon’s instructions say that the sheets stay the same throughout the test and that each statement relates to one sheet. Its interface walkthrough shows six tabs. The task includes finding the relevant source; you do not need to combine figures from different sheets.   1. 1. Identify the measure and period

    Read what the statement actually compares: revenue, cost, quantity, share, rate or forecast. Notice the company, segment and year.

  2. 2. Open the relevant tab

    Use the sheet titles as a map. Read the title, row and unit together; similar numbers elsewhere may describe a different measure.

  3. 3. Check whether the inputs exist

    A missing period or delivery count may settle the question before any calculation. Do not fill a gap with an assumption.

  4. 4. Calculate only what is needed

    Set up the comparison, use the calculator if useful and check rounding. Keep the relevant sheet visible while making your judgment.

Reading tables & charts

Locate the right sheet, row, period and unit. Read chart labels before comparing the visible lengths or heights.

Watch for: A figure labeled “thousands” is not an absolute count. Check whether it describes one segment or the whole business.

Percentages & changes

For relative change, divide the difference by the original value. For percentage points, subtract the rates directly.

Watch for: A share of sales and the growth in sales have different denominators. Check which quantity the statement names.

Ratios & rates

Write the units of a rate: items per hour, revenue per employee, or cost per item. Calculate comparable rates before judging the claim.

Watch for: A larger total can come with a lower rate. Reversing the ratio answers a different question.

Totals & averages

Identify which rows belong in the total. For an overall average, combine the underlying totals and counts.

Watch for: Do not count a subtotal twice. Unequal groups need a weighted average.

Forecasts & conversions

Apply the stated growth or conversion rule only to its specified base and periods. Keep enough precision until the final comparison.

Watch for: A forecast is not an actual result. Successive changes compound, and an exchange rate must be used in the stated direction.

Evidence & missing data

Ask whether the sheet supplies every input needed to settle the statement. Distinguish a contradiction from a missing figure or definition.

Watch for: A missing year is not a zero. Cost, revenue, quantity and market share are different measures.

Prepare for a short, continuous clock

Dividing 12 minutes by 37 gives about 19.5 seconds per statement. This is a pacing reference, not a separate deadline for each item or a requirement to finish all of them. Some judgments need only a lookup; others need a calculation.

Before starting

Have a calculator, paper and pen ready. Read the instructions and try the introductory examples before beginning the timed portion.

During the sitting

Keep a steady pace. Use the statement picker to move past a difficult item and return if time remains. The full practice clock keeps running while you navigate.

Before finishing

Use remaining time to check uncertain statements and unanswered items. You can revise full-practice answers until final submission or time expiry.

Aon’s practice instructions recommend a calculator and rough paper and allow navigation between statements. Follow the exact rules in your real assessment. Improve accuracy and coverage together

Track how many statements you judged correctly, how many you attempted, and which mistakes repeat. Reaching more items helps only when you can still interpret them reliably. Review a correct guess as carefully as an incorrect answer.

Check the marking instructions before your real test. For example, SMU’s compact numerical test awards one point for a correct answer, deducts half a point for an incorrect one and gives zero for a blank. That is a documented example, not a promise that every employer uses identical scoring. SMU: Aon candidate guide, including the compact numerical test.

Common questions

Is Aon Numerical Reasoning the same as digitChallenge?

No. This practice covers scales numerical: judging statements using tables and charts. digitChallenge is an arithmetic game, while gapChallenge and switchChallenge test different reasoning skills. Use the name and examples in your invitation to choose the right practice.

What does Cannot Say mean?

The supplied evidence cannot establish whether the statement is true or false. Missing values, missing periods or a different measure can make this the correct answer. If the data are sufficient but you have not worked out the calculation, that alone does not justify Cannot Say.

Do I have to answer every statement?

Aon’s guidance says candidates are not expected to finish every task. Practice making accurate judgments efficiently instead of clicking through all 37 at any cost. Unanswered items and incorrect answers tell you different things about what to improve.

Can I use a calculator?

Yes, you can use a calculator and rough paper here. Aon’s numerical practice instructions recommend having them ready. Follow the specific instructions for your real assessment; do not assume it supplies an on-screen calculator.
